Caroline Kinderthain Named 2015 Lilly Scholar

Last updated on Tuesday, March 31, 2015

(BEDFORD) - Caroline Kinderthain is the 2015 Lilly Scholar for Lawrence County.

Caroline, the daughter of John and Heather Kinderthain, will receive a full-tuition scholarship to a four-year public or private college or university. The scholarship also includes an annual stipend of $900 for required books.

The 18-year-old senior at Bedford North Lawrence High School, plans to study elementary education in college.
She's considering attending Indiana State University or possibly Indiana Wesleyan University.

Thirty-five students applied for the scholarship, according to the Lawrence County Community Foundation. A selection committee, made up of community residents, narrowed the field to the top 10.

Those finalists included Kinderthain, Kyla Addison, Isaac Crane, Anna Cummings and John Underwood from BNL and Nolan Cox, Kamri Duncan, Trevin Grissom, Angela Sabo and Kyle Waggoner from Mitchell.

The 10 finalists completed an impromptu essay and were interviewed by the selection committee. Two - a potential recipient and an alternate -- were submitted to the Independent Colleges of Indiana for final selection.

The Lilly Endowment Community Scholarships are the result of a statewide Lilly Endowment initiative to help Hoosier students reach higher levels of education.
